Output 75c1096de11eaa03357aa44662f2f3db9d26ad5a50f67d832d95b58a55225a86:1

value
600840
script pubkey
OP_0 OP_PUSHBYTES_20 ec2273d96346360b1ea436c1981372a35a89d787
address
ltc1qas388ktrgcmqk84yxmqesymj5ddgn4u8euzlsu
transaction
75c1096de11eaa03357aa44662f2f3db9d26ad5a50f67d832d95b58a55225a86
spent
true